The Goldsmith - The Goldsmith has four bedrooms - two of which benefit from an en suite - an open-plan kitchen, breakfast and family area, a separate living room and a dining room.

On the ground floor, the U-shaped kitchen has a breakfast bar, providing an informal dining area, as well as generous worktop space for food preparation. Soft-close units feature a range of integrated appliances, comprising a fridge freezer, dishwasher, single oven, gas hob and cooker hood - all by Zanussi. French doors in the family area open on to the rear garden. The utility room, which lies off the kitchen contains a second sink unit, offering extra prep space, as well as plumbing for a washing machine.

The living and dining rooms are situated towards the front of the house, overlooking the landscaped garden.

On the first floor, bedrooms 1 and 2 each have an en suite shower room, while the remaining bedrooms share the family bathroom. All bathrooms are presented with Roca white sanitaryware, Bristan chrome-finish brassware and tiling to the walls.

Sandalwood Green - Sandalwood Green is a development of exclusive new homes in Hempsted, less than three miles away from Gloucester city centre.

Situated on the outskirts of Gloucester, Sandalwood Green has access to a variety of high-quality entertainment and leisure facilities, including museums, art galleries, and parks.

A little under a 10-minute drive away from the development is the Museum of Gloucester, which features collections of paintings, stories of the city's origins, and much more.

Roughly 30 minutes' drive away is Newbridge Farm Park, which is ideal for families as the site contains an outdoor play area, tractor rides, sandpits, and other activities.

Around 15 miles away from Sandalwood Green is Berkeley Castle, a 6,000-acre estate in Gloucestershire that is comprised of a deer park, farms, cottages, and pubs - as well as the 11th-century castle itself.

There are plenty of options for those looking to commute for work, as Gloucester Railway Station is only around two miles away from Sandalwood Green and offers trains to Cheltenham, around a 10-minute trip, and Bristol, about a 50-minute journey.

Anyone who prefers to drive can reach Gloucester city centre in under 10 minutes, while Cheltenham is roughly 20 minutes' drive and Bristol around 40
